DLCQuest: Add missing indirect conditions (#5074)

The `Behind Rocks` and `Pickaxe Hard Cave` Entrances require being able
to reach the `Cut Content` region, but no indirect conditions were being
registered for this region.

The `set_lfod_self_obtained_items_rules` function was also using a
`world` parameter that was actually expecting a `MultiWorld` instance,
so I have renamed it for clarity and updated the function to use
`world.get_entrance()` rather than `multiworld.get_entrance()`.

Much of the rest of the file passes `MultiWorld` instances to `world`
parameters, but fixing all of these is out of the scope of the changes
in this patch, so has not been included.
